Java Support Engineer

1 week ago


Karachi, Sindh, Pakistan dotCMS Full time 40,000 - 80,000 per year

What is the role?

dotCMS is currently seeking a
Java Support Engineer - Tier 1
. This role performs deep investigation of technical issues with the dotCMS product, platform, and code base, and delivers solutions to a wide range of customer issues.

This isn't a tedious position with a standard playbook – the majority of our support requests are for new issues unique to specific environments and use cases. But if you enjoy new and varied challenges, and the opportunity to advance in your front-end, back-end, or full-stack development skills, we'd love to talk to you.

Additionally, you will participate in an on-call rotation, ensuring critical support coverage and a seamless client experience. If you thrive on variety, enjoy solving complex problems, and are excited by the chance to work across the full stack, we'd love to connect with you.

This is a
full-time on-site contractor
position based in
Karachi
. The work schedule is from
3:00 PM to Midnight local time (UTC+05:00),
with a one-hour break. We are currently unable to sponsor or assume sponsorship of employment visas.

What is dotCMS?

Founded in 2003, dotCMS is the most agile, scalable and secure content management system for enterprise. Built on leading Java technology, dotCMS is an open-source, universal content management system that gives developers the flexibility of a headless CMS while equipping marketers with no-code visual content authoring. Whether you're building a network of global websites, an employee intranet, a customer portal, or a single-page web application, dotCMS helps you manage content, images, and assets in one centralized location and deliver them to any channel. Some of our notable customers include Telus, Standard & Poors, Hospital Corporation of America, Royal Bank of Canada, Deutsche Bank, Comcast, Vodafone, Thomson Reuters, Dairy Queen, Lennox International, , and O'Reilly Autoparts.

Who are we, really?

At "the dot," you'll find a diverse team of authentic individuals who share the goal of building the most agile, scalable, and secure content management system, delighting customers, and having a lot of fun doing it. We're a curious, innovative, and collaborative group that works from anywhere. Whether it's to enjoy the beautiful views of new countries or just more "you" time outside of work.

What you'll bring to the team:

  • Provide remote technical support for dotCMS software products and services, including:
  • Interact directly with clients via the support ticketing system and occasionally schedule video meetings
  • Reproduce customer-reported issues
  • Isolate-reported issues in configuration, implementation, and/or dotCMS code
  • Respond with technical and creative solutions to client problems
  • Resolve technical issues and requests about the product and implementations, including:
  • Submit bug reports, enhancement requests, and suggested bug fixes
  • Provide feedback to R&D, documentation, and customer success on issues & resolutions
  • Participate in daily support stand-ups and regular development team meetings
  • Take part in rotating pager duty shifts to provide off-hours support for critical customer issues
  • Contribute to other support-related technical and development projects as requested

Why we get excited about you:

  • 2+ years of Java development experience; full-stack a plus
  • 2+ years experience with web technologies including HTML and CSS; SCSS a plus
  • 2+ years with front-end or back-end scripting languages; JavaScript and Apache Velocity a plus
  • Proven and demonstrable analytical, problem-solving, and communication skills
  • Ability to speak and write English fluently
  • Enjoys working in a team-oriented, collaborative environment
  • Bachelor's Degree or equivalent experience in a technical field

Additional desirable experience

  • Relational database administration; PostgreSQL a plus
  • Developing on Linux; AWS Linux a plus
  • Working with/within Docker containers; Kubernetes a plus
  • Administrating cloud-hosted environments; AWS a plus
  • Professional use of Version Control Systems; GitHub and Zenhub a plus
  • Implementing JavaScript libraries and frameworks such as jQuery, Angular, React, and

Why should you join?

If you have great experience but are tired of being a cog in a giant corporate wheel, this job is for you. It's a chance to create a new product marketing function at an established, growing company with a mature product in use by major global organizations. Everything you do every day, will have a huge impact on our company. Your work will be seen, felt and recognized and your past experience valued.

Your Compensation.
We offer competitive compensation that allows you to make a great living for yourself and your loved ones.

Your Team.
We are a humble, competitive, and small vendor making waves in our industry, and you will be part of a team that has your back. You never walk alone We are a diverse and distributed team, and we offer annual company-paid training and development to our employees.

Your Voice.
Your voice matters to all of us, and we appreciate your opinion as we scale our company to the next level in an open and transparent environment. We will periodically update the entire team on business performance and strategic initiatives and offer the stage for an entrepreneurial-minded professional to produce key initiatives that help to move the needle.

Your Benefits.
We value you as an individual, team member, and professional. We can only expect you to deliver high performance within the right amount of You-time. Therefore, you will have access to a PTO policy (after the first 90 days in the company) and a generous number of local company-paid holidays.

dotCMS is an equal opportunity employer and prohibits discrimination and harassment of any type and affords equal employment opportunities to employees and applicants without regard to race, color, religion, sex, sexual orientation, gender identity or expression, pregnancy, age, national origin, disability status, genetic information, protected veteran status, or any other characteristic protected by law.



  • Karachi, Sindh, Pakistan OpenPort Full time 40,000 - 80,000 per year

    Java Spring Boot Developer— Karachi (Full-time)OpenPort is a pan-Asian startup on a mission to make trucking, logistics, and supply chains more efficient in Emerging Markets through an open, neutral, AI-driven platform. Our systems have already processed 800,000+ shipments, moved over 5 million tons of freight, and traveled 500M+ km, and we're growing our...

  • Java Developer

    19 hours ago


    Karachi, Sindh, Pakistan OpenPort Full time 1,200,000 - 3,600,000 per year

    Java Developer — Karachi (Full-time)OpenPort is a pan-Asian startup on a mission to make trucking, logistics and supply chains more efficient in Emerging Markets through an open, neutral, AI-driven platform. Our systems have already processed 800,000+ shipments, moved over 5 million tons of freight and traveled 500M+ km and we're growing our development...

  • Java Developer

    2 weeks ago


    Karachi, Sindh, Pakistan Avanza Solutions Full time 1,800,000 - 3,600,000 per year

    We're Hiring – Senior Software Engineer (Java)Location: KarachiExperience: 3–5 YearsAbout the Role:Avanza Solutions is looking for a Senior Software Engineer (Java) to join our dynamic team in Karachi. The ideal candidate will have hands-on experience in developing scalable applications using Java, Spring Boot, and front-end frameworks such as React or...

  • Java Developer

    2 weeks ago


    Karachi, Sindh, Pakistan SocialPie Technologies Full time 1,200,000 - 3,600,000 per year

    Job Title: Java DeveloperLocation: OnsiteEmployment Type: Full-TimeAbout the Role:We are seeking a highly skilled Java Developer with 4-5 years of professional experience to join our growing engineering team. The ideal candidate will have strong expertise in handling legacy Java codebases, modernizing applications, and migrating monoliths to...

  • java developer

    2 weeks ago


    Karachi, Sindh, Pakistan Avanza Solutions Full time 144,000 - 1,440,000 per year

    Position: Java DeveloperLocation: KarachiIndustry: Fintech / Software DevelopmentRole Overview:We are looking for a skilled Java Developer to design, develop, and maintain enterprise-grade applications. The ideal candidate will have strong hands-on experience in Java, Spring Boot, and Microservices with the ability to work in a fast-paced, collaborative...

  • Java Architect

    2 weeks ago


    Karachi, Sindh, Pakistan Nisum Full time 1,500,000 - 2,500,000 per year

    We are looking for a highly experiencedJava Architectwith deep expertise inJava, Spring Boot, Kafka, and Keycloak, along with practical exposure toLLM-based conversational AI integrations. The role involves designing and leading scalable enterprise backend architectures, mentoring teams, and ensuring high availability, performance, and security across...


  • Karachi, Sindh, Pakistan DevGate Full time 1,200,000 - 3,600,000 per year

    Job Title: Senior Java DeveloperLocation:Karachi, PakistanJob Type:Full-time | On-siteExperience Level:SeniorAbout the RoleWe are looking for an experienced and highly motivatedSenior Java Developerto join our dynamic team atDevGate. As a key member of our development team, you will be responsible for designing, developing, and maintaining robust, scalable,...

  • Java Developer

    1 week ago


    Karachi, Sindh, Pakistan Truck It In Full time 1,200,000 - 3,600,000 per year

    About The Role:We're looking for a talented Java Engineer to join our dynamic team across our offices in Pakistan. In this role, you'll design, develop, and maintain server-side applications while ensuring scalability and security. Collaborating with architects and cross-functional teams, you'll write clean code, create tests, and document technical details....

  • Java Developer

    1 week ago


    Karachi, Sindh, Pakistan HR Ways - Hiring Tech Talent Full time 250,000 - 750,000 per year

    Company Description:Our client is a Pakistan-based IT consulting firm with 30+ years experience delivering enterprise solutions to public, private, and donor-funded sectors.Job OverviewWe are looking for passionate and motivatedComputer Science graduateswho are eager to kickstart their careers inJava Development and Quality Assurance (QA). This is an...

  • Java Developer

    19 hours ago


    Karachi, Sindh, Pakistan HR Ways Full time 300,000 - 600,000 per year

    Company Description:Our client is a Pakistan-based IT consulting firm with 30+ years experience delivering enterprise solutions to public, private, and donor-funded sectors.Job OverviewWe are looking for passionate and motivated Computer Science graduates who are eager to kickstart their careers in Java Development and Quality Assurance (QA). This is an...